Using Corrective Body Makeup To Hide Imperfections
A cosmetic product not as widely used or well known as foundation or coverup for the face, is something called corrective body makeup. It works in much the same way as foundation or coverup, except that it is used for your hands, legs, arms, or anywhere else on your body!
Some women have scars or other imperfections on their hands that make them feel self conscious. If you have blotchy skin from too much sun exposure, flaws including age spots, bruises, varicose veins, unsightly birth marks or stretch marks, or even for a tattoo you want to cover or hide- covering up with some corrective body makeup can help you feel better about yourself and more confident.
Water Resistant
Corrective body makeup is perfect for days at the beach and even when swimming! When wearing a bathing suit, there is very little you can "hide"; but when you slather some of this product over your arms, legs, feet, hands (and belly if wearing a two piece!) you can minimize the effects of skin imperfections and create a more flawless look. Corrective body makeup is smudge and water resistant, so it will stay on even as you swim, splash ...
... with the kids or play in the sand.
Other Benefits of Corrective Body Makeup
In addition to helping you look good and feel better about yourself, the corrective body makeup products also protect your skin against harmful effects of the sun because it includes a sunscreen. As if that wasn't enough, it also contains moisturizing ingredients and treats your body with gluconolactone, polyhydroxy acid and antioxidants.
Corrective body makeup also has a slight tinge of color to it, so it can be used for a natural looking tan- perfect when just starting out the summer season before you've had a chance to bronze your pale, winter skin! Just choose the shade that closest matches your skin if you don't want to appear tanned, and choose a slightly darker shade when you are looking for that sun-kissed look.
Hiding Tattoos
Whether you love your tattoo or you regret the day you let someone brand you with a needle- you can slather on some corrective body makeup whenever you want to hide your tattoo. Perhaps you have a job interview and don't want an obvious tattoo to create the wrong first impression; or maybe you've changed your mind about your tattoo and wish it never happened? Hide it with the body makeup until you have the time to have your tattoo removed!
